Daily Madden: 49ers Must Prepare For A Season Without Crabtree
The 49ers lost their top receiver when Michael Crabtree tore his Achilles tendon in practice Tuesday. Coach Jim Harbaugh said Crabtree could return in mid-November. But John Madden told the KCBS Radio morning crew the 49ers should prepare for a full season without him.

Pats Agree To 2-Year Deal With Former Raiders DT Tommy Kelly
Hoping to fortify their interior defensive line alongside perennial Pro Bowl tackle Vince Wilfork, the New England Patriots have agreed to terms on a two-year deal with former Oakland Raiders defensive tackle Tommy Kelly.

Bay Area Native Tom Brady Gets 3-Year, $27M Extension With Pats
Tom Brady will be a Patriot until he is 40 years old. Brady agreed to a three-year contract extension with New England on Monday.
